The story of Dukot Queen is one of the most persistent urban legends and controversial chapters in Filipino entertainment, involving actress Sunshine Cruz

and an unfinished film project that was leaked to the public in the early 2000s. The Film: Dukot Queen

Originally intended to be a "sexy drama" directed by Tikoy Aguiluz for Viva Films, the movie starred Sunshine Cruz alongside Jay Manalo. The plot centered on a runaway girl who becomes a pickpocket (mandurukot) in Quiapo.

Production Halt: Production only lasted about two days. Sunshine Cruz reportedly quit the project in late 2000 to marry actor Cesar Montano, leading to the film being shelved indefinitely.

The Leak: Despite being unfinished, explicit footage from these two days of filming was stolen and leaked. A technician at a film laboratory was reportedly fired for tampering with the negatives and distributing the footage as an "X-rated" VCD under titles like Dukot Queen. Clarifying the Controversy

Over the years, various rumors circulated about the footage, including claims that Cesar Montano had "bought" the film's rights to protect his wife's reputation. Sunshine Cruz has since clarified several points: sunshine cruz dukot queen 06 avi hot

Not a "Scandal": She maintains that the footage consisted of professionally filmed movie scenes for a legit project, not a private "scandal" video.

Unfinished Project: She confirmed the movie remained unfinished because her family no longer wanted her to pursue such "sexy" roles after her marriage.

No Buyout: She refuted rumors that her ex-husband bought the negatives; rather, Viva Films simply held the materials to prevent further use. Career in 2006 and Beyond
